The exact Riemann solutions to the generalized Chaplygin gas equations with friction

The exact solutions to the Riemann problem for the one-dimensional generalized Chaplygin gas equations with a Coulomb-like friction term are constructed explicitly.

The position, strength and propagation speed of delta shock wave are obtained completely.

The Coulomb-like friction term make waves (including rarefaction, shock and delta shock) bend into parabolic shapes for the Riemann solutions.
